Very rare in this exterior great condition These cases typically date to the late 1940s to early 1950s. Design Context: The artwork features a Lockheed Constellation aircraft flying from the US East Coast to Europe. This design likely commemorated the expansion of transatlantic passenger flights after World War II, specifically the routes started by TWA around 1946. Maker: Ibelo was a well-known German manufacturer, and this specific model is often referred to as an "Occupied Germany" era piece because it reflects the maps and connections of that period.
